WebHere is an un-engineered Diamondback Explorer fitted for exploration that will get you to 35 Ly jump range. If you have Horizons you can engineer it and add a guardian FSD booster that will get 60+ easily. If you can't afford an A-rated fuel scoop you can get by with B-rated for now but upgrade it when you can.

WebMay 12, 2024 · The goals are: Build a ship for exploring. Exploration requires a long jump range to reach distant star systems, a Fuel Scoop for refuelling, a Detailed Surface Scanner (DSS) to map planets and a Planetary Vehicle Hangar to house a Surface Reconnaissance Vehicle (SRV).
